With a claimed fuel efficiency of 91 miles per gallon, the Porsche Panamera S E-Hybrid is set to become the world's first plug-in electric luxury sports car hybrid. The 416-horsepower V6 bi-turbo engine takes the Porsche from 0 - 100 km/h in 5.5 seconds, half a second quicker than the standard Panamera Hybrid. Charging time is approximately 2.5 hours with an estimated driving range of around 23 miles and top speeds of 80mph when in all-electric mode.

Check out the first images of the vehicle above and look for it to hit the market in July at a price of around $140,000.
